Location: 2201 N Stemmons Fwy, Dallas, TX 75207
Hours: 9 a.m. – 7 p.m. daily
Parking: Parking is available at a cost of $25 + tax for daily parking, and $36 for overnight parking. We recommend parking in the nearest lot to Jade Waters, which is furthest away (to the right) when you enter the main complex.

If you are staying at the Hilton Anatole and the Jade Waters Resort Pool is open (it has a seasonal opening) entry wristbands are included in your resort charge.
Additional wristbands are available for purchase at $35 each per day (up to two per room).

Jade Waters Resort Pool and WaterPark
Jade Waters is not your typical “waterpark”; it is a resort-style pool with other typical water park features, some beautiful landscaping, tons of seating options, and a lot of shade.
They have a couple of winding Water Slides. Their water slides are fun and fast but not too scary in our opinion. One is tubed and one is open. The water slides usually don’t have extra long lines and move quickly.

A really great Kids Area with a 7000 square foot Splash and Play Kids Zone which is perfect for kids to splash and play with tons of lounge chairs close by.
The activity pool has different play areas and includes an extra large water dump bucket tower that empties every minute, a water playscape, and basketball hoops.
Kids will also love the beach entry pool which is perfect for littles to acclimatize to the water.
And do not forget the Lazy River: 630 feet of lazy river where you can relax on tubes past waterfalls, spray bars, and several garden sculptures.



What Dining Options are there at the Jade Waters Resort Pool?
The Jade Waters Resort Pool Bar and Grill. It’s a food court-like area that offers sit-down service, but you can have your food in your lounge area as well, and cabana service is also available for you.
Open daily from 11 a.m. – 6 p.m.

Is there an Adult only pool?
Yes-ish, a leisure cove pool with hot tubs close by and a swim-up bar with in-pool seating. The swim bar only serves adult beverages to over 21’s. It’s a perfect place to kick back leisurely, and enjoy a cocktail or adult beverage with full eyesight across the Jade Waters Resort Pool complex.
It’s very close to one part of the lazy river and the cabanas, so you can supervise any kids who are resting in the cabana from the adult-only pool deck and it’s easy to spot your kids using the slides or enjoying the rest of the Jade Waters Resort Pool and Water Park.

Reserve a Cabana or Day Beds
Private Cabanas and daybeds are available to registered hotel guests at the Hilton Anatole Resort and visitors for daily rental during operating hours.
The cabanas include exclusive amenities such as reserved chaise lounges, a large flat-screen TV, a ceiling fan, a mini-fridge, water bottles, a tropical fruit platter, a welcome amenity, and a dedicated server.
Private Cabanas (seats 8 people) Daybeds (seats 2-4 people)

Does Jade Waters Resort Pool provide towels?
Yes, they do! There is no need to pack your own or use your towels from your room if you’re staying as one of their registered hotel guests at the Hilton Anatole in the Summer season.
They’re also full-size beach towels, which is a bonus.
If you’re looking for an Indoor Pool, there is an indoor pool inside the Atrium Tower area of the hotel.
